Labasa hammers Nadroga 6-2 in Women's IDC

Labasa defeated Nadroga 6-2 in their Group A match of the Digicel Women's IDC at Lawaqa Park this evening.

Cema Nasau scored four goals on her debut for Labasa while Sofi Diyolowai scored twice.

Varanisese Tuicakau and Melika Masei scored for Nadroga.

Nadroga was beaten 6-2 by Suva in the opener yesterday and has bowed out of the competition.

In an earlier match today, defending champions Ba thrashed Rewa 5-0.

Koleta Likuculacula and Narieta Leba scored two goals each while Litia Tadulala scored the final goal just before full-time.

The final round of pool matches will be played tomorrow with Suva playing Labasa at 3pm before Ba plays Tailevu Naitasiri at 5pm.
